Introduction: An estimated 1.5 million cases were reported in Pakistan until 23 March, 2022. However, SARS-CoV-2 PCR testing capacity has been limited and the incidence of COVID-19 infections is unknown. Volunteer healthy blood donors can be a control population for assessment of SARS-CoV-2 exposure in the population. We determined COVID-19 seroprevalence during the second pandemic wave in Karachi in donors without known infections or symptoms in 4 weeks prior to enrollment.
Materials and methods: We enrolled 558 healthy blood donors at the Aga Khan University Hospital between December 2020 and February 2021. ABO blood groups were determined. Serum IgG reactivity …

OBJECTIVE:
To evaluate the frequency of subclinical lead toxicity.
STUDY DESIGN:
Cross-sectional study.
PLACE AND DURATION OF STUDY:
Department of Pathology and Laboratory Medicine, The Aga Khan University Hospital, Karachi, from January 2011 to December 2014.
METHODOLOGY:
Analysis of laboratory data for blood lead levels (BLL) was performed. Lead was tested by atomic absorption spectrometer. For all subjects, only initial test results were included while the results of repeated testing were excluded. Exemption was sought from institutional ethical review committee. BLL of 2-10 ug/dl and 10-70 ug/dl in children and adults, respectively were taken as subclinical lead toxicity.
